目录1. zookeeper搭建:2. 集群搭建2.1. 集群规划如下:2.2. node1免密配置2.3. 更新修改hadoop,yarn 配置文件2.4. scp 复制到其他节点2.5. 删除之前集群的tmp文件2.6. 启动zookeeper2.7. 启动 journalnode2.8. 格式化集群2.9. 同步第二个namenode2.10. 格式化ZK2.11.启动hdfs集群2.12
转载
2024-05-01 19:50:01
52阅读
第十一章、Zookeeper一、Zookeeper简介 1.什么是Zookeeper
Zookeeper是r是一个中心化的服务,一个开源的、
分布式的应用程序协调服务。它提供了一套原语集,通过这套原语集,可以实现更高层次的同步服务、配置管理、集群管理以及命名管理。
总的来说就是:
Zookeeper保证了数据在集群中的事务一致性。
Zookeeper通常有奇数个节
转载
2023-08-08 11:25:20
766阅读
hadoop2.0已经发布了稳定版本了,增加了很多特性,比如HDFS HA、YARN等。最新的hadoop-2.6.0又增加了YARN HA
注意:apache提供的hadoop-2.6.0的安装包是在32位操作系统编译的,因为hadoop依赖一些C++的本地库,
所以如果在64位的操作上安装hadoop-2.6.0就需要重新在64操作系统上重新编译
一.重新编译
继 Hadoop 之 ZooKeeper (一) 4. 使用 ZooKeeper 构建应用 (Building Applications with ZooKeeper) 4.1 一个配置服务 (A Configuration Service) 分布式应用所需要的基本服务之一是配置服务,它使配置信息中那些公共的部分可以由集群中的机器共享。简单来说,Zo
转载
2024-08-02 11:10:17
76阅读
1、环境说明 集群环境至少需要3个节点(也就是3台服务器设备):1个Master,2个Slave,节点之间局域网连接,可以相互ping通,下面举例说明,配置节点IP分配如下: Hostname IP 新建用户 新建用户密码 Master 10.10.10.213 hadoop 123456 Slave1 10.10.10.214 hadoop 123456 Slave2 10.10.10.21
转载
2024-06-11 11:40:21
29阅读
目录 简述zookeeper安装zookeeper启动原理hadoop HA参照:简述zookeeper是Google的Chubby一个开源的实现。它是一个针对大型分布式系统的可靠协调系统,提供的功能包括:配置维护、名字服务、分布式同步、组服务等。ZooKeeper的目标就是封装好复杂易出错的关键服务,将简单易用的接口和性能高效、功能稳定的系统提供给用户。zookeeper重在协调,是分
转载
2024-08-30 14:52:01
96阅读
# Zookeeper与Hadoop的关系详解
Zookeeper和Hadoop是大数据架构中两个极为重要的组件。Zookeeper是一个分布式协调服务,而Hadoop则是一套分布式存储和处理框架。理解它们之间的关系和如何结合使用,对于开发和管理大规模数据应用至关重要。
## 整体流程
为了让小白能够更清晰地理解Zookeeper与Hadoop之间的关系,我们可以将整个流程分为以下几个主要步
一、大数据介绍Volume(大量)Velocity(高速)快速计算Variety(多样)结构化数据、非结构化数据Value(低价值密度)快速对有价值数据“提纯”二、全局架构介绍三、各各组件介绍zookeeper:为分布式框架提供协调服务,文件系统+通知机制工作机制 基于观察者模式设计的分布式服务管理框架,负责存储和管理大家都关心的数据,然后接受观察者的 注册,一旦这些数据的状态发生变化,Zooke
转载
2024-03-28 19:34:22
567阅读
zookeeper,有些听说过,有些人没有,本人也是因为自己在做一个分布式的系统,由dubbo+zookeeper整合,所以接触一下。到底是什么东西?关于这个问题我首先到其官网和百度百科。其大致就是zookepper是hadoop的一个子项目,Apache软件基金会下的一个项目
转载
2023-10-01 20:11:35
261阅读
本教程使用liunx系统centos 7.0,hadoop2.7.4,zookeeper 3.4.10版本,jdk 1.8。hadoop部署4个节点,2个nameNode节点,4个dataNode节点。zookeeper部署3个节点。 一、修改4台服务器名称 &nb
转载
2024-04-07 21:50:15
107阅读
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域名服务、分布式同步、组服务等。ZooKeeper的目标就是封装好复杂易出错的关键服务,将简单易用的接口和性能高效、功能稳定的系统提供给用户。Zookeeper架构图:Zookeep
转载
2023-10-20 06:40:27
135阅读
zookeeper简介Hadoop的原始安装包下面只提供HDFS以及MapReduce两个功能,其他的生态组件需要自己安装,这里本人首先遇到的是zookeeper,一个分布式服务框架,它能提供下面这些功能:配置维护域名服务分布式同步组服务等zookeeper维护一个类似于文件系统的服务结构,每一个文件目录都被称为是一个znode,我们可以随意增加、删除这些znode,同时znode下面是可以保存数
转载
2023-12-06 18:21:05
218阅读
zookeeper篇zookeeper特性 一个客户端做出修改,所有客户端可以立即发现修改内容初识zookeeper zookeeper的一个应用场景:有一组服务器提供某种服务,我们希望客户端都能找到其中一台服务器,然后我们需要维护这组服务器的成员列表,这个列表不能在某个服务器上,来避免单点故障,并且如果某个服务器出现故障,那么就需要从列表中删除改节点。这个场景不是一个被动的分布式结构,它能够在某
转载
2023-08-01 17:48:19
101阅读
## Zookeeper和Hadoop的关系
### 概述
Zookeeper是一个开源的分布式协调服务,而Hadoop是一个分布式处理框架,它们之间有着密切的关系。在Hadoop集群中,Zookeeper通常被用来管理和维护集群的状态信息,以及协调各个节点之间的通信,确保集群的稳定运行。
### 流程概述
在Hadoop集群中使用Zookeeper,需要进行一系列步骤来配置和启动Zookee
原创
2024-05-21 11:12:50
190阅读
# Zookeeper与Hadoop的关系
在大数据的生态系统中,Zookeeper和Hadoop是两个相互关联的重要组件。Hadoop是一种开源的分布式计算框架,专为处理海量数据而设计,而Zookeeper则是一个用于管理分布式系统的协调服务。本文将探讨这两者之间的关系,并通过代码示例来加深理解。
## Zookeeper的功能
Zookeeper为分布式系统提供了一系列基础服务,其中包括
ZooKeeper是Google的Chubby提供的一个开源的、分布式的框架,它是Hadoop集群的管理者,同时提供一致性协调服务,就像“人民法官”一样监视着集群中各个节点的状态根据节点提交的反馈进行下一步合理操作。最终实现将简单易用的接口和性能高效、功能稳定的系统提供给用户的功能。Zookeeper主要负责存储和管理大家都关心的数据,一旦这些数据的状态发生变化,Zookeeper就会通知那些注册
转载
2023-10-20 18:43:13
140阅读
Apache Hadoop HDFS`一.Apache Hadoop 简介Hadoop的起源要从Google三篇论文说起[① gfs ② MapReduce ③ Bigtable], 当时hadoop的开发者Dout Cutting 正在Lucene的子项目Nortch项目中需要对大量网页数据进行检索提取处理,并提取有用的数据,在看到此三篇论文后相继开发出了HDFS,MapReduce,在加上后续
转载
2023-09-21 15:42:31
85阅读
Zookeeper基本原理Zookeeper简介Zookeeper顾明思议动物园管理员,它是拿来管大象(Hadoop),蜜蜂(Hive),小猪(Pig)的管理员,Apache HBase和Apache Solr以及LinkedinSensei等项目中都采用到了Zookeeper。Zooke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Hadoop和HBase的重要组件,Zookeep
转载
2023-10-17 21:53:31
79阅读
Zookeeper/Hbase/Hadoop三者之间的关系,在此我把三者之间的关系画在一张图上希望能表达的清楚一些。Zookeeper用来同步Hbase服务状态、监控集群防止单点失效HDFS是Hadoop中最核心的一部分,用来对Hbase的数据进行存储1、Zookeeper客户端与服务端的大致结构 服务端 Zookeeper还是属于一个C
转载
2024-08-16 10:23:30
37阅读
1、简介ZooKeeper最早起源于雅虎研究院的一个研究小组,在立项初期,发现很多项目都是用动物的名字来起的,当时首席科学家觉得不能再继续起动物的名字了,把它起名叫动物园管理员,正好它分布式协同服务的特性很相符,所以ZooKeeper诞生了。顾名思义 zookeeper 就是动物园管理员,他是用来管 hadoop(大象)、Hive(蜜蜂)、pig(小 猪)的管理员, Apache Hbase 和
转载
2023-08-04 14:14:21
184阅读